diff options
Diffstat (limited to 'deps/npm/node_modules/nopt/node_modules/osenv/node_modules/os-homedir/index.js')
-rw-r--r-- | deps/npm/node_modules/nopt/node_modules/osenv/node_modules/os-homedir/index.js | 24 |
1 files changed, 0 insertions, 24 deletions
diff --git a/deps/npm/node_modules/nopt/node_modules/osenv/node_modules/os-homedir/index.js b/deps/npm/node_modules/nopt/node_modules/osenv/node_modules/os-homedir/index.js deleted file mode 100644 index 33066166fe..0000000000 --- a/deps/npm/node_modules/nopt/node_modules/osenv/node_modules/os-homedir/index.js +++ /dev/null @@ -1,24 +0,0 @@ -'use strict'; -var os = require('os'); - -function homedir() { - var env = process.env; - var home = env.HOME; - var user = env.LOGNAME || env.USER || env.LNAME || env.USERNAME; - - if (process.platform === 'win32') { - return env.USERPROFILE || env.HOMEDRIVE + env.HOMEPATH || home || null; - } - - if (process.platform === 'darwin') { - return home || (user ? '/Users/' + user : null); - } - - if (process.platform === 'linux') { - return home || (process.getuid() === 0 ? '/root' : (user ? '/home/' + user : null)); - } - - return home || null; -} - -module.exports = typeof os.homedir === 'function' ? os.homedir : homedir; |